New technology may store captured carbon dioxide in concrete
IE 11 is not supported. For an optimal experience visit our site on another browser.Now PlayingNew technology may store captured...
IE 11 is not supported. For an optimal experience visit our site on another browser.Now PlayingNew technology may store captured...
Engineers from the University of Delaware designed a strategy for proficiently capturing 99 per cent of carbon dioxide from the...